This paper is original from "On-line Measuring System for Cragged Surface on Special Working Conditions", supported by the Science and Technology Research Foundation of Anhui Province. One aim of this project is to research on the technique of measuring geometric parameters on train wheel profile applying stereovision measurement technology.People have been researching on the techniques of measuring geometric parameters on train wheel profile for decades at home and abroad. Many techniques have been achieved and proved to be practical. They have been changed from traditional mechanical and contact measurement to photoelectric techniques. With the development of computer image processing and photoelectric techniques, stereovision measurement techniques have been widely used in industrial measurement. The stereovision measurement techniques will be used for the measurement of on-line train wheel profile parameters.Two linear laser lights used in the measuring system project to the surface of the wheel. The pictures are collected by the left and right CCD, and dealed with PC to find out the data of the curve of the wheel profile and account for the parameters.The author independently works on: building model of the dynamic measuring system, the research of the method of curves connecting, the analysis and improving of the static and dynamic measure system errors, and the system soft ware integration.
